Job SummaryYou will serve as a MANAGEMENT AND PROGRAM ANALYST in the Force Training (N7) of COMNAVSURFPAC.

QualificationsYour resume must demonstrate at least one year of specialized experience at or equivalent to the GS-12 grade level or pay band in the Federal service or equivalent experience in the private or public sector analyzing and evaluating naval manpower and personnel training programs for efficacy, development, or reform. Additional qualification information can be found from the following Office of Personnel Management web site: https://www.opm.gov/policy-data-oversight/classification-qualifications/general-schedule-qualification-standards/#url=List-by-Occupational-Series Experience refers to paid and unpaid experience, including volunteer work done through National Service programs (e.g., professional, philanthropic, religious, spiritual, community, student, social). Volunteer work helps build critical competencies, knowledge, and skills and can provide valuable training and experience that translates directly to paid employment.

Major DutiesYou will be responsible for the communication, coordination and integration of the Career Training Continuum (CTC) program.You will liaise with Fleet personnel to restructure current curricula so relevant training is delivered.You will coordinate and direct all aspects of the CTC program to Type Commander via N7 leadership.You will collect information and create integrated transition status briefs.You will establish milestones and analyze issues, monitor project scope, requirements and schedules, and provide reoccurring status briefs.You will monitor and report on the efficacy of modernizing training in the fleet.
